> Temporary destinations not being cleaned up upon delete() when using network 
> of brokers

> When deleting a temp destination a DestinationInfo object is sent signifying 
> the deletion to brokers. These are not deleted immediately but are instead 
> put into the cachedDestinations map in AbstractTempRegion. Upon the regular 
> scheduled doPurge call any that are older than a minute are disposed of, 
> however, calling remove on the cache map returns nothing because the key 
> object, CachedDestination has a bug inside the equals method in the 
> instanceof check and the temp destinations stick around and are never 
> disposed of
>             if (o instanceof ActiveMQDestination) {
> Should be 
>             if (o instanceof CachedDestination ) {
